A luxury hospitality group in Manchester is seeking an experienced Night Receptionist to ensure a seamless front-of-house experience overnight. The ideal candidate will have 2-3 years’ experience in a front desk role, preferably in luxury hospitality or private members clubs, and strong communication skills.
Key responsibilities include:
- Handling guest check-ins and requests
- Maintaining a calm and professional environment
This position offers competitive compensation and numerous employee perks, including training and discounts.

How to prepare for a job interview at Soho House via Caterer.com
✨Know Your Luxury Hospitality
Make sure you brush up on the latest trends and standards in luxury hospitality. Familiarise yourself with what sets a luxury members club apart from other establishments, and be ready to discuss how your experience aligns with these expectations.
✨Showcase Your Communication Skills
Since strong communication is key for this role, prepare examples of how you've effectively handled guest interactions in the past. Think about times when you resolved issues or went above and beyond to ensure a guest's satisfaction.
✨Stay Calm Under Pressure
As a Night Front Desk Lead, you'll need to maintain a calm and professional environment. Prepare to discuss scenarios where you've successfully managed stressful situations, highlighting your problem-solving skills and ability to keep things running smoothly.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ions that show your interest in the role and the company. Inquire about their approach to guest experience or how they support their staff’s development.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if it’s the right fit for you.
